Angela Borukhova, et al., appellants, v Ligho Feeza Hosein, et al., respondents; Valeriy Y. Borukhova, counterclaim defendant-respondent. (Index No. 3705/09)
| DECISION & ORDER ON MOTION |
Separate motions by respondent Sonia Bracley, and the counterclaim defendant-respondent, Valeriy Y. Borukhova, to dismiss an appeal from an order of the Supreme Court, Queens County, dated April 21, 2011, as untimely taken against them.
Upon the papers filed in support of the motions and no papers having been filed in opposition or in relation thereto, it is
ORDERED that the motions are granted and the appeal taken against the respondent Sonia Bracley and the counterclaim defendant-respondent, Valeriy Y. Borukhova, is dismissed without costs or disbursements (see CPLR 5513[a]).
FLORIO, J.P., CHAMBERS, HALL and MILLER, JJ., concur.
